Subject: CSV wizard handover

Hi Priya,

Handing over the Marloway CSV import wizard ahead of my leave. For the external plugin authors: the wizard stages uploads in the `import_staging` schema, and plugins may read staged rows but must never write to them. Validation hooks fire pre-commit; keep handlers under two seconds. Staging tables truncate nightly. Plugin sandboxes should connect using the string below.

warehouse DSN: mongodb://prair_svc:Sa7NQM1@db-329b.merlaqcorp.corp:5432/fendor

FAQ: Where is the evacuation chair kept?

The Ashfell office evacuation chair is in the store cupboard next to Stairwell B, Level 3. New starters: locate it during your first-week walkaround with your buddy. Do not remove it except in an emergency or during fire-warden drills. The cupboard stays locked. To open it, use the code below.

turnstile pass: bdg-QZV-3

Artifact Signing — Chronoform Report Exports. All export bundles, including the timezone normalization patch shipping this week, must be signed before the Driftline scheduler accepts them. The patch converts report timestamps to each workspace's configured zone at render time rather than at storage, so unsigned legacy bundles will be quarantined. If paged for a quarantine event, re-sign the bundle and resubmit. The current artifact signing key is listed below.

rollout seal: bky4_x7Gc

- [ ] **Step 7 — Verify planner baseline before key rotation (Ortolan DB 9.3).** Before the ceremony proceeds, confirm the query planner regression from build 9.3.1 is not present on the ceremony replica: run the canned join-order suite and check that plan hashes match the 9.2.6 baseline. If any hash differs, halt and page the storage lead — do not rotate keys against a degraded replica. Once the baseline matches, the release manager unseals the ceremony vault using the passphrase below.

recovery phrase for yafog-hadug: ulaix-frawyn